WebJun 10, 2014 · public class CamelCaseExceptDictionaryKeysResolver : CamelCasePropertyNamesContractResolver { protected override JsonDictionaryContract CreateDictionaryContract (Type objectType) { JsonDictionaryContract contract = base.CreateDictionaryContract (objectType); contract.PropertyNameResolver = … WebMay 10, 2024 · Use NewtonSoft.Json and the JSON you get is { "version":1.0, "health":100, "powers": { "Hadoken":15, "Electricity":20, "Rocket":25, "Kick":20 } } A Dictionary will be exported as a normal JSON Object with only int properties. .net fiddle sample Share Follow edited May 10, 2024 at 12:51 answered May 10, 2024 at 12:40 Sir Rufo
Custom Dictionary JsonConverter using System.Text.Json - Josef …
WebAug 20, 2014 · public Dictionary> roaming = new Dictionary> (); and this is how i tried to serialize it: string json = JsonConvert.SerializeObject (this.client); // the dictionary is inside client object //write string to file System.IO.File.WriteAllText (@"path", json); WebOct 7, 2024 · static void Main (string [] args) { // example instances List> list = new List> (); Dictionary dict1 = new Dictionary () { {"First", new ObjectA { AID=1 , AName="ANAME_NO_1"} }, {"Second", new ObjectB { BID =2,BName="BNAME_NO_1",IsChecked=true} }, }; Dictionary dict2 = new Dictionary () … raytech temp gun
Convert a Dictionary to string of url parameters in C#?
WebNext, we serialize the list to JSON using the JsonConvert.SerializeObject method. This method converts the list of objects to a JSON array of objects, where each object has a value property. Finally, we display the resulting JSON in the console. Note that in this example we use an anonymous type to create the objects in the list. WebFeb 20, 2024 · To write JSON to a string or to a file, call the JsonSerializer.Serialize method. The following example creates JSON as a string: C# using System.Text.Json; namespace SerializeBasic { public class WeatherForecast { public DateTimeOffset Date { get; set; } public int TemperatureCelsius { get; set; } public string? WebCreate Custom DictionaryConverter for JSON Serialization. In this article, we shall create a custom DictionaryInt32Converter for int32 or enum as keys for JSON serialization using C# .NET example.. As we know the new .NET /ASP.NET Core 3.1 onward framework has removed the dependency on JSON.NET and uses its own JSON serializer i.e … raytech surgical instrument